Core i7-8700T vs Xeon E3-1245 V2 benchmarks
According to the hardwareDB Benchmark tool, the Core i7-8700T is faster than the Xeon E3-1245 V2. Despite this, the Xeon E3-1245 V2 has the advantage in our gaming benchmark.
In terms of the number of cores of each of these CPUs, the Core i7-8700T has significantly more cores than the Xeon E3-1245 V2. Indeed, the Core i7-8700T has 6 cores compared to 4 cores found in the Xeon E3-1245 V2. It also has more threads than the Xeon E3-1245 V2. With our hardware info, we find that the Xeon E3-1245 V2 has a slightly higher clock speed than the Core i7-8700T. The info from our database shows that the Core i7-8700T has more L2 cache than the Xeon E3-1245 V2. The Core i7-8700T also has significantly more L3 cache.
The more cores a CPU has, the better the overall performance will be in parallel workloads such as multitasking. Many CPUs have more threads than cores, this means that each physical core is split into multiple logical cores, making them more efficient. Indeed, the Core i7-8700T has more threads than cores.
